红外遥控码型分析:EPSON与NEC协议详解

需积分: 10 2 下载量 55 浏览量 更新于2024-09-14 收藏 700KB DOC 举报
本文主要介绍了两种常见的红外遥控码型,分别是Epson大投影仪遥控器使用的SIRC协议和小投影仪、Pioneer-DVD、RC-6228采用的NEC协议,以及它们的主要特征。 1. **SIRC协议** - **协议特点**:SIRC(Sony Infrared Remote Control)协议由Epson大投影仪遥控器采用,分为12位、15位和20位版本,这里主要讨论12位版本。 - **码型结构**:包括5位地址码和7位命令码,总长度为12位。 - **调制方式**:使用脉冲宽度调制,40kHz的载波频率,位时间长度为1.2ms或0.6ms。 - **脉冲组合**:高600us低600us(00)、高1.2ms低600us(11)、高600us低1.2ms(01),没有高1.2ms低1.2ms的组合。 - **启动脉冲**:启动脉冲为2.4ms高电平,0.6ms低电平,用于接收端的自动增益控制。 - **重复发送**:如果按键持续按下,码型每76ms重复发送一次,无特殊重复码。 2. **NEC协议** - **协议特点**:NEC协议常见于小投影仪、Pioneer-DVD等设备,特点是8位地址码和8位命令码,为提高可靠性,完整发送两次。 - **调制方式**:脉冲时间长短调制,38kHz的载波频率,逻辑"1"脉冲时间为2.25ms,逻辑"0"脉冲时间为1.12ms。 - **码型发送**:地址码和命令码各发送两次,确保数据正确接收。 - **推荐占空比**:载波周期推荐为1/4或1/3。 - **脉冲链示例**:协议规定低位先发送,如发送的地址码为"59"。 红外遥控码型的理解和分析对于开发红外遥控设备或编写相关驱动程序至关重要。SIRC和NEC协议是家用电器和多媒体设备中广泛使用的两种码型,理解它们的工作原理有助于实现跨设备的兼容性和自定义遥控功能。在实际应用中,需要根据设备的特定码型来解码或编码红外信号,以实现遥控操作。